Crochet Tablecloth - Whether indoors or outdoors, this tablecloth is a real eye-catcher. In the summer, it brightens up your garden, and in the winter, it adds extra ambiance to your home. The tablecloth is crocheted using the filet technique. Following a stitch pattern, you’ll crochet “closed” and “open” squares, creating a lovely pattern in your work. The beautiful flower motif repeats throughout, resulting in a cheerful floral tablecloth!

What you need to know before crocheting the tablecloth:
- In this pattern, the repeat is repeated 3 times across and 7 times down.
- In this pattern, the turning chains are not counted as stitches; they are only used to create height for the New round. Work the first stitch into the last stitch of the previous round.
- To crochet an open (white) square, work as follows: (1 double crochet), 2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et. To crochet a closed (black) square, work as follows: (1 double crochet), 3 double crochets. Note: The first square of the row consists of 4 stitches; the following squares consist of 3 stitches (the last double crochet of the previous square is also the first double crochet of the next square).


Dimensions: 1.65 x 1.00 m
Crochet Tablecloth Pattern
Video Tutorial: Crocheting a Tablecloth
Start with color 74. Using a 3.5 mm hook, crochet 208 chain stitches.
Continue crocheting with a 3 mm hook.
Row 1: 2 chain stitches, 1 double crochet in the 3rd chain stitch from your hook, **1 double crochet in the next 6 stitches,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 3 times. 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 14 times, 6 double crochets. Repeat from ** 2 more times. Turn your work.
Row 2: 2 chain stitches, 1 double crochet, **3 double crochets,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 20 more times. 3 double crochets. Repeat from ** 2 more times. Turn your work.
Row 3: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 10 more times,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 10 times. Repeat from ** 2 more times. Turn your work.
Row 4: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 8 times. 12 double crochets, repeat from * to * 10 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 5: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 6 times. 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 6 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 6: 2 chain stitches, 1 double crochet, **3 double crochets,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 4 times. 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time, 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 7 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 7: 2 chain stitches, 1 double crochet, **3 double crochets,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 6 times. 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 2 times, 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 5 times, 3 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 8: 2 chain stitches, 1 double crochet, **3 double crochets,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 3 times. 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 6 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 9: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 4 times. 12 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 12 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 4 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 10: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 3 times. 12 double crochets, repeat from * to * once; 12 double crochets, repeat from * to * once; 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* once; 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 5 times. Repeat from ** twice. Turn your work.
Row 11: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 5 times. 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 5 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 12: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 6 times. 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 2 times, 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 8 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 13: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 6 times. 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time, 9 double crochets, repeat from *-* 6 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 14: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 5 times, 6 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from *-* 1 time, 6 double crochets, repeat from *-* 7 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 15: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 9 times, 12 double crochets, repeat from * to * 9 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 16: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 9 times, 6 double crochets, repeat from * to * 11 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 17: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 22 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 18: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from * to * 22 times.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 19: 2 chain stitches, 1 double crochet, **3 double crochets,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, repeat from *-* 4 times, 3 double crochets, repeat from *-* 15 times, 3 double crochets.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Row 20: 2 chain stitches, **1 double crochet, *2 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ches, 1 double crochet*,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 13 times,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 1 time, 3 double crochets, repeat from * to * 3 times, 6 double crochets. Repeat from ** 2 times. Turn your work.
Repeat rows 1–20 six more times. This means a total of 7 times the pattern lengthwise and 3 times the pattern widthwise.
THE EDGE:
You'll end up in the top left corner. Then you'll continue crocheting along the long side to make the edge.
Tip: To make the pattern easier to follow, start a new round in the corners. However, for a neater finish, it’s better to start in a different spot each time.
Row 1: Chain 2, 1 double crochet in each stitch. (Work 2 double crochets in the chain stitches.) Work 1 additional double crochet in each corner. Join the row with a slip stitch in the first stitch.
Row 2: Using color 74 (Opaline Glass), work 1 double crochet in each stitch all around, and work 1 additional double crochet in the corner. Fasten off. Close the row with a slip stitch in the first stitch and fasten off.
Row 3: Join with color 17 (Papaya). Crochet a half double crochet in each stitch all around, and in the corners, crochet 1 single crochet, 3 chain stitches, skip 1 chain stitch, 1 single crochet. Close the row with a slip stitch in the first stitch and fasten off.
Row 4: Join color 45 (Blossom) to the corner chain-3 loop: 1 single crochet, 3 chain stitches, *1 single crochet, 3 chain stitches, skip 2 stitches. Repeat from *. In each corner chain-3 loop, work 1 single crochet, 3 chain stitches, 1 single crochet. Close the round with a slip stitch in the first stitch and fasten off.
Row 5: Join color 15 (Mustard) in the chain arch at a corner. 2 chain stitches, 3 joined double crochets, 5 chain stitches, *to the next arch, 3 joined double crochets, 3 chain stitches. Repeat from *. In the corners, crochet 5 chain stitches, 3 joined double crochets, 5 chain stitches. Close the round with 5 chain stitches and a slip stitch in the first stitch.
Row 6: Join with color 43 (Pearl) to the chain arch from the previous row. Crochet 3 double crochets in each arch. In the corners: 5 chain stitches. Close the row with a slip stitch in the first stitch and fasten off.
Row 7: Join with color 66 (Blue Lake) between 2 groups of double crochets. 1 chain stitch, *1 single crochet, 3 chain stitches, skip 1 group of double crochets, repeat from *. In the corners, chain 5. Close the row with a slip stitch in the first stitch.
Row 8: 1 slip stitch in the arch, 2 chain stitches, *in the arch, work a 4-yarn-over stitch (**wrap the yarn around your hook, insert the hook through the arch, and pull the yarn through. Repeat from * 3 times, wrap the yarn around the hook and pull through all 9 loops) 3 chain stitches, move to the next arch. Repeat from *. In the corners, chain 5, work a 4-yarn-over loop, chain 5. Close the round with a slip stitch in the first stitch and fasten off.
Row 9: Join color 37 (Cotton Candy) to the 5-chain arch. 1 chain stitch, *1 single crochet, 5 chain stitches, 1 single crochet in the next arch. Repeat from *. Join the row with a slip stitch in the first stitch and fasten off.
